Total Crime Rate
196.4 per 1,000
All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Dunston Road area has the 9th highest crime rate of 60 local areas in Lavender , and the 130th highest crime rate of 825 local areas in Wandsworth .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Dunston Road (SW11 5YB) in the last 12 months was 196.4 per 1,000 residents and was 43.1% higher than the Lavender average (137.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 29 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other theft with 1 case , down -83.3%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-83.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 22 (β 65.5 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 10.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 63.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Dunston Road (SW11 5YB),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 184 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Turnchapel Mews (18 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
